The invention relates to a process for the preparation of 3-mercaptopropionic ester from H2S and acrylic ester in the presence of 3,3'-dithiodipropionic ester, in which an insoluble anion exchanger resin is used as catalyst in a batch-like or continuous procedure and the ester is synthesised in a technologically relevant way, the reaction temperature being approximately 0 to 60 DEG C and the reaction pressure being 0 to 13.5 kg/cm<2> (G) (G: manometric pressure), the yield of 3-mercaptopropionic ester being 91 to 96% based on the acrylic ester and its purity being above 99%, measured by GLC (gas liquid chromatography). In this invention, the 3-mercaptopropionic ester is synthesised in high yield and high purity and is suitable for conditions or uses in industry. The advantages of this invention are that 3-3'-dithiodipropionic ester, which is present during the reaction, is not utilised at all and can be used repeatedly and, since the anion exchanger resin is used as catalyst, it can be removed from the reaction system by a simple filtration.
